Pigeons discount continuously changing perspective during action recognition
Robert G Cook1, Daniel Brooks1, Muhammad A J Qadri1
1Department of Psychology, Tufts University.
Pigeons can distinguish human actions from camera movement. This study shows pigeons effectively process changing perspectives when identifying articulated motions versus static poses.
Area of Science:
- Comparative psychology
- Animal cognition
- Visual perception
Background:
- Distinguishing self-motion from external motion is crucial for visual systems.
- Understanding how animals process complex visual information, especially motion, is key to visual neuroscience.
Purpose of the Study:
- To investigate pigeons' ability to discriminate articulated human actions from static poses.
- To determine if pigeons can discount camera motion while processing visual stimuli.
- To explore the generalizability of this visual processing capacity in pigeons.
Main Methods:
- Three experiments used a go/no-go action discrimination task with four pigeons.
- Pigeons viewed 20-second videos of a digital human model with changing camera perspectives.
- Stimuli included articulated motions, static poses, novel sequences, silhouettes, and conditional discriminations.
Main Results:
- Pigeons successfully discriminated articulated actions from static poses.
- The birds readily discounted continuous camera motion during the task.
- The capacity to process actions under changing perspectives was found to be general.
Conclusions:
- Pigeons demonstrate a robust ability to separate and discount changing camera perspectives.
- This visual processing capability allows pigeons to accurately perceive actions in dynamic environments.
- The discrimination relies primarily on global action cues, with a minor role for statistical image features.
